Error when opening property inspector in 2022a
23 views (last 30 days)
Show older comments
dear community,
when i open my property inspector from the menue of a figure, i get the following error
Dot indexing is not supported for variables of this type.
Error in matlab.graphics.internal.propertyinspector.PropertyInspectorManager>@(x)x.ModeManager.CurrentMode.Name=="Standard.EditPlot" (line 112)
'-function', @(x) x.ModeManager.CurrentMode.Name == "Standard.EditPlot",...
Error in matlab.graphics.internal.propertyinspector.PropertyInspectorManager.removeFigureDTClientListenersIfNeeded (line 111)
allFigures = findobj(0,'-depth',1,'type','figure',...
Error in matlab.graphics.internal.propertyinspector.PropertyInspectorManager/temporarilyStopInspectorListeners (line 347)
this.removeFigureDTClientListenersIfNeeded();
Error in matlab.graphics.internal.propertyinspector.propertyinspector (line 93)
hInspectorMgnr.temporarilyStopInspectorListeners();
Error in matlab.graphics.internal.propertyinspector.propertyinspector (line 19)
matlab.graphics.internal.propertyinspector.propertyinspector('show');
Error in viewmenufcn (line 52)
matlab.graphics.internal.propertyinspector.propertyinspector('toggle');
i recently upgraded from 2021a to 2022a, in the old version this did not happen.

Hi, I had the same issue with Matlab R2022b and R2023a when trying to open property inspector from command line or via figure toolbar button (figure opene using figure, not uifigure). As a workaround I just fixed it (caution: admin rights required) by adding a non-empty check in that function callback:
'-function', @(x) ~isempty(x.ModeManager.CurrentMode) && x.ModeManager.CurrentMode.Name == "Standard.EditPlot",...
